Christopher Nicks Has Passed Away
Nicks’ niece, Jessica “Nixi” Nicks, took to Instagram to reveal that her father Christopher Nicks — younger brother of the rock icon — had passed away at age 72 after a long battle with cancer.
In a touching Instagram post, she shared a photo of her hand laying atop that of her father.
In the caption, she wrote, “second star to the right, and straight on till morning. i love you, daddy rest easy.”
‘A Broken Heart’
She shared a more expansive tribute to her late father via Instagram Story.
“It is with a broken heart that I announce the passing of my father, Christopher Aaron Nicks, early this morning, surrounded by family,” she wrote, as reported by AOL.
In her post, she revealed that her father had been engaged in a private battle with cancer.
“Some of you may know that he has spent the last 2.5 years battling a cancer diagnosis, and to some this may come as a shock,” she continued. “If this is news to you, please know it was because he never wanted people to worry about him that he kept this to himself.”
She concluded her post by recalling the impact that her late father had on the people who knew him.
“I know that he has left his mark on so many people, and this will leave many more than his immediate family with a piece of them missing,” she wrote. “I know I speak for my dad when I say that his friends, his lost boys, meant the world to him.”
A Close Relationship
The singer’s brother was married to Lori Petty, Nicks’ longtime background singer. Before their divorce, they welcomed daugther Jessica, Stevie Nicks’ niece.
Even after Nicks skyrocketed to fame with Fleetwood Mac, she and Christopher remained close.
In a 2003 interview with You Magazine, Stevie admitted that their relationship was far more turbulent when they were children. “By the time I was five, I was a little diva. I was out of control, so my parents decided to have another child,” she recalled.
“I hated Chris, my brother. I would pull his hair and kick him, until one day my father gave him permission to fight back. I’ll be apologizing to him for the rest of my life,” she joked.
As she explained, when she wasn’t on tour or recording, she retreated to stay with Christopher, Lori and Jessica in a house they shared in Phoenix, Arizona.
“My parents live five minutes away. At Christmas I’ll be home for six weeks. That’s when I bond with my family. My mom collects my cuttings; Chris does my merchandizing and Lori is one of my backing singers,” she said at the time.
“Chris sat with me when three girls were killed in a car crash after going to my show. I needed someone to tell me it was not my fault. Nobody but Chris could get that over to me,” she added.
